
In a Hadith found in Sahih Muslim, number 1528, the Holy Prophet Muhammad, peace and blessings be upon him, advised that the most beloved places to Allah, the Exalted, are the Mosques and the most hated places to Him are the market places.
Islam does not prohibit muslims from going to places other than the Mosques, nor does it command them to always inhabit the Mosques. But it is important that they prioritize attending Mosques for the congregational prayers and attending religious gatherings, over visiting the markets and other places, unnecessarily.
When a need arises there is no harm to attend other places, such as shopping centers, but a muslim should avoid going to them unnecessarily, as they are places where sins more often occur. Whenever they do go to other places they must ensure they avoid disobeying Allah, the Exalted, which includes wronging others. They should avoid over socialising, as this is the cause of the majority of sins, which occur in society.
The Mosques are meant to be a sanctuary from sins and a comfortable place to obey Allah, the Exalted, in. This involves fulfilling the commands of Allah, the Exalted, refraining from His prohibitions and facing destiny with patience according to the traditions of the Holy Prophet Muhammad, peace and blessings be upon him. Just like a student benefits from a library, as it is an environment created for studying, similarly, muslims can benefit from Mosques, as their very purpose is to encourage muslims to obtain and act on useful knowledge so that they can obey Allah, the Exalted, correctly.
Mosques are also an excellent place to remind one of their purpose, which is to sincerely obey Allah, the Exalted, by using the blessings they have been granted in ways pleasing to Him. The Mosques also encourage one to prioritise their activities in the correct way, so that they fulfill their necessities and responsibilities, prepare adequately for the hereafter and enjoy lawful pleasures in moderation. The one who avoids the Mosques often wastes their time and resources on vain and pointless activities and they therefore lose out on gaining benefit in both worlds.
Not only should a muslim prioritize the Mosques over other places but they should encourage others, such as their children, to do the same. In fact, it is an excellent place for the youth to avoid sins, crimes and bad company, which lead to nothing but trouble and regret in both worlds.
